Nicholson & Sons Ltd, High/Pineapple Brewery, 75 High Street, Maidenhead, Berkshire.
Founded by Robert Nicholson 1840 as the Pineapple Brewery.
Bought by Charles H.J.Emery in 1897, then the South Berkshire Brewery Co. Ltd in 1900.
Registered as a limited company 1903.
Acquired by Courage, Barclay & Simonds Ltd. 1958 and closed 1961.
Now the Nicholson Walk shopping complex.
Stables remain.
